Event

RECOMP – Reuse and Recycling of Composites

Wednesday, 23 - Thursday, 24 Nov 2022

AMRC, Sheffield

Tim Young - Head of Sustainability, Vicky Summers - Principal Research Engineer, James Graham - Chief Engineer: Surface Transport, Kyle Pender - Advanced Research Engineer, from the National Composites Centre, will be participating in RECOMP 2022 - Reuse and Recycling of Composites, organised by Composites UK. 

Returning for a second time after a successful launch in 2020, the Recomp conference will look at all aspects of re-use, repurposing and recycling of fibre-reinforced polymer composite materials and will be hosted at the Advanced Manufacturing Research Centre near Sheffield, UK.

Topics covered:

Recomp 2022 will cover the following topics:

  • The composites end of life challenge – views from UK, Europe and globally
  • The OEM views on end-of-life composites by sector
  • The potential reuse/repurposing opportunities
  • The potential recycling opportunities
  • Navigating the challenge – how to make the right decisions about composites waste
